Early detection of malnutrition or nutritional risk and appropriate management is the crucial step to fight against malnutrition. Nutritional screening and assessment of patients on admission to hospital or nursing home, adequate follow up with nutritional support and regular monitoring are the four steps to tackle malnutrition and to stop the vicious cycle.
